码迷,mamicode.com
首页 > 数据库 > 详细

启动sqlserver服务的bat脚本分享

时间:2015-06-09 14:18:00      阅读:188      评论:0      收藏:0      [点我收藏+]

标签:

声明下这个脚本不是我写的,忘了是从哪看到的了,在此分享给大家,因为在我的理解中技术就是用来分享的,希望原创作者看到了不要介意。

1.创建个文本,将后缀名改成.bat

2.将下边语句粘贴进去,然后保存即可

复制代码代码如下:


@echo off 
for /f "skip=3 tokens=4" %%i in (‘sc query MSSQLSERVER‘) do set "zt=%%i" &goto :next

 

:next 
if /i "%zt%"=="RUNNING" ( 
 echo 已经发现该服务在运行,开始停止
 net stop  MSSQLSERVER
 echo sc config MSSQLSERVER start = DISABLED 禁用服务
) else ( 
 echo 该服务现在处理停止状态,开始启动
 echo sc config MSSQLSERVER start = Manual 设置服务手动
 net start MSSQLSERVER
)

pause


需要注意的地方是 ‘MSSQLSERVER‘这个是sqlserver默认的实例名字,www.js-code.com如果你服务器上有多个实例的话,需要手动替换下脚本里的服务名。

启动sqlserver服务的bat脚本分享

标签:

原文地址:http://my.oschina.net/u/2392464/blog/464515

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!